Output 1ab34b8ee88da4b93832c91d00dd531c12eb87fdaf0f65db4c8ec84e8feb27a2:0

value
419606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d4a942e0ce6830af13f3d447478af99b52108e OP_EQUAL
address
3ChumXAueZUzFTCxbzpungMFbpFeqAS5HK
transaction
1ab34b8ee88da4b93832c91d00dd531c12eb87fdaf0f65db4c8ec84e8feb27a2
spent
true